How the online payment flow actually works
At a high level, online card processing is a coordinated exchange between the customer, the payment gateway, the processor, the card network, the issuing bank, and the merchant’s acquiring bank. The customer enters card details at checkout, the payment request is encrypted, and the system asks the issuing bank for approval. If approved, the merchant receives an authorization code, the order can move forward, and the funds are captured and settled later.
That sounds simple, but several decision points happen in seconds:
- The gateway tokenizes and transmits the payment data securely.
- The processor routes the transaction to the correct network such as Visa, Mastercard, American Express, or Discover.
- The issuing bank checks available credit, fraud signals, card status, and transaction patterns.
- The network passes the response back to the processor and merchant.
- After authorization, the merchant captures funds and the batch settles, usually within one to three business days.

Who is involved in each transaction
One reason payment pricing feels opaque is that multiple parties get paid from a single card transaction. Each party performs a specific function:
Customer
The buyer initiates the payment by entering card details, using a saved card, or tapping a digital wallet such as Apple Pay or Google Pay.
Payment gateway
The gateway is the secure technical layer that captures card data and sends it for authorization. Many modern providers bundle gateway and processing into one product, but some enterprise setups still use separate vendors.
Payment processor
The processor manages the movement of transaction data between the gateway, card networks, and banks. It also handles authorization, clearing, settlement, and reporting.
Acquiring bank
This is the merchant’s bank partner, often called the acquirer. It receives the funds from the transaction after settlement and deposits them into the merchant account.
Issuing bank
This is the customer’s card-issuing bank. It approves or declines the transaction based on the customer’s credit limit, account status, and risk profile.
Card network
Visa, Mastercard, American Express, and Discover operate the network rails and set many of the interchange and compliance rules that shape pricing.

What fees you really pay
Most merchants focus on the headline rate, but that rate rarely tells the full story. Online payment costs usually fall into four buckets: interchange fees, assessment fees, processor markup, and added service fees.
Interchange fees
Interchange is usually the largest cost component. It goes to the issuing bank and varies by card type, transaction method, merchant category, and risk level. Rewards cards and manually keyed transactions often cost more than basic consumer cards or lower-risk transactions.
Assessment fees
Assessment fees go to the card networks. They are usually smaller than interchange, but they are part of every card transaction.
Processor markup
This is what your processor charges on top of interchange and assessments. Pricing models may include interchange-plus, flat-rate, tiered, or subscription-based billing. For many online merchants, interchange-plus offers the clearest cost visibility, while flat-rate can be simpler for smaller businesses with modest volume.
Additional service fees
These can include monthly account fees, PCI compliance fees, gateway fees, chargeback fees, cross-border fees, currency conversion fees, instant payout fees, and fraud-screening add-ons.
Here is where many businesses lose margin:
- International cards can trigger higher processing and FX costs.
- Card-not-present transactions cost more than in-person payments because the fraud risk is higher.
- Poor fraud rules can increase manual review volume and false declines.
- Weak checkout design can shift customers away from lower-cost payment methods.

How security and compliance protect card data
Online credit card processing is only as strong as the security controls behind it. Customers expect frictionless checkout, but regulators, banks, and card networks expect merchants to reduce the exposure of sensitive card data.
PCI DSS compliance
PCI DSS is the baseline security standard for businesses that store, process, or transmit cardholder data. The latest version places stronger emphasis on ongoing security practices, not just annual checkbox compliance. If you use hosted fields, tokenization, and a reputable provider, your PCI scope can be significantly lower.
Tokenization and encryption
Tokenization replaces card details with a non-sensitive token so merchants do not need to store raw card numbers. Encryption protects the data while it moves through the payment flow. Together, they reduce breach risk and lower compliance exposure.
Fraud screening and authentication
Good processors support tools such as AVS, CVV checks, device fingerprinting, behavioral analysis, velocity rules, and 3D Secure. These controls help stop stolen-card usage, but if configured too aggressively, they can block real customers.
Chargeback prevention
Chargebacks are not just a fraud problem. They can result from confusing billing descriptors, delayed fulfillment, subscription misunderstandings, or poor customer support. Best provider types for different business models
There is no single best provider for every merchant. The right fit depends on volume, geography, checkout complexity, chargeback profile, and the need for subscription billing, marketplaces, or omnichannel support.
Best for startups and simple ecommerce
Flat-rate providers such as Stripe or Square are often attractive for newer businesses because onboarding is quick, APIs are mature, and developer documentation is strong. The tradeoff is that flat pricing may become expensive at scale.
Best for scaling DTC brands
Brands processing more meaningful monthly volume often move toward interchange-plus providers or custom enterprise pricing. These setups can improve economics, offer stronger account support, and reduce risk of sudden reserve actions if the provider understands the business model.
Best for subscription and SaaS companies
Subscription-heavy businesses need dunning tools, card updater services, smart retries, account lifecycle reporting, and strong recurring billing logic. A low transaction rate means less if involuntary churn keeps rising.
Best for global sellers
Merchants selling internationally should prioritize local acquiring, multicurrency support, tax-aware invoicing, and optimized routing. Best for high-risk categories
Travel, supplements, digital goods, coaching, gaming, and certain continuity models often need specialized underwriting and reserve planning. A mainstream processor may approve the account initially, then tighten terms later if disputes rise.

Common mistakes that hurt conversion and profit
Even strong brands leave money on the table when they treat payments as a back-office utility. The most common mistakes are operational, not technical.
Choosing based only on the advertised rate
A low headline fee can hide expensive add-ons, weak support, or poor approval rates. If 2 percent more customers are declined, the savings disappear quickly.
Using aggressive fraud rules without review
Fraud tools should be tuned to your business model. High-ticket B2B invoices, impulse digital purchases, and recurring subscriptions all produce different risk patterns.
Ignoring failed payment recovery
Subscription businesses especially need account updater services, retry logic, expiration reminders, and customer self-service options. Otherwise, failed payments become silent churn.
Not planning for chargebacks early
Once the chargeback ratio rises, fixing it takes time. Clear cancellation rules, fast support, fulfillment proof, and better transaction descriptors should be in place before disputes spike.
Depending on one provider forever
A single-provider setup is simple, but it can reduce leverage and create downtime risk. Larger merchants often benefit from backup routing or at least periodic repricing reviews.
How to choose the right processor
The best selection process balances cost, security, support, and growth plans. Use a disciplined evaluation instead of signing up with the first recognizable brand.
Questions every merchant should ask
- What is the real effective rate after interchange, assessments, and added fees?
- How are chargebacks handled, and are pre-dispute alerts available?
- What fraud tools are included by default, and what costs extra?
- How fast do funds settle, and are reserves possible for this business model?
- Does the provider support recurring billing, global payments, or marketplace logic if needed?
- Will the checkout support wallets, one-click flows, and local payment preferences?
A practical selection process
- Map your payment model: one-time, subscription, invoice, marketplace, or mixed.
- Calculate your current effective processing cost, including hidden fees and chargeback expenses.
- Review decline codes and identify whether fraud controls or issuer responses are causing avoidable losses.
- Shortlist providers based on your volume, countries served, and risk category.
- Request pricing transparency, settlement timelines, contract terms, and support escalation details.
- Run a controlled test if possible, then compare approvals, payout timing, and dispute trends.
For many businesses, the winning move is not switching providers immediately. It is first cleaning up the checkout flow, improving customer communication, and understanding the transaction mix. Once that data is clear, negotiating better terms becomes easier.

Why are online processing rates higher than in-person card rates?
Online payments are card-not-present transactions, which carry more fraud and dispute risk than chip-present in-store payments. Because the risk is higher, interchange and processor pricing are usually higher as well.
